#b1b1d5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b1b1d5 is composed of 69.4% red, 69.4% green and 83.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 16.9% cyan, 16.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 240 degrees, a saturation of 30% and a lightness of 76.5%. #b1b1d5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6363ab. Closest websafe color is: #9999cc.

Shades and Tints of #b1b1d5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06060b is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#b1b1d5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bfbfc7 is the less saturated color, while #8787ff is the most saturated one.
